The Importance of a Strong Password

Strong passwords are the frontline defense against cyber threats and breaches.

They protect personal information, financial data, and online accounts.

A simple password can lead to devastating consequences.

  • Statistics show that over 80% of data breaches are due to weak or stolen passwords. Source
  • NIST recommends using passwords that are at least 12 characters long, mixing letters, numbers, and symbols.

Why You Need Unique Passwords

Unique passwords are crucial to your security. Here are key reasons why they matter:

  1. Prevention of Account Duplication

    • Using the same password for multiple accounts increases risk. If one account is compromised, others are too.
  2. Protection from Data Leaks

    • In 2021 alone, over 3 billion accounts were leaked due to infamous breaches Source.
  3. Enhanced Security

    • A unique password mitigates the impact of hacks.

If one password is compromised, your other accounts remain safe.

Common Password Mistakes to Avoid

Avoid these pitfalls to ensure your password security:

  • Reusing passwords across different sites.

  • Ignoring password complexity requirements.

  • Creating easily guessable passwords e.g., ‘123456’, ‘password’.

  • Neglecting to update passwords periodically.

Mistake Impact
Reusing passwords High risk of mass account compromise
Using weak passwords Easy targets for cybercriminals
Not updating regularly Increased vulnerability to ongoing attacks

Character Selection and Complexity

When generating passwords, complexity is key. High entropy means better security. A strong password should include:

  • Lowercase letters a-z
  • Uppercase letters A-Z
  • Numbers 0-9
  • Symbols !@#$%^&*

Complexity example:

Instead of using ‘password123’, a safer option might be ‘F@5t!S&9d2%^’.

Ensuring Unpredictability

Unpredictability is crucial in password management. Examples of ensuring unpredictability:

  1. Lengthy passwords at least 12 characters.
  2. Random character sequence.
  3. Avoiding dictionary words.
